What does the word "Annabelle" mean?

The name "Annabelle" is a beautiful and timeless moniker that combines elegance with a sense of charm. It is derived from two distinct roots: the Latin name "Anna" and the Latin/French word “Belle.” The meaning of Annabelle can thus be interpreted as "grace" or "favor" (from Anna) and "beautiful" (from Belle). Together, they create a name that represents both gracefulness and beauty, making it a popular choice among parents wishing to bestow a meaningful name upon their daughters.

What does the word "Nonanoic" mean? The term "nonanoic" refers to a specific type of fatty acid, which is part of the larger family of carboxylic acids. Also known as pelargonic acid, nonanoic acid is an aliphatic fatty acid that consists of a straight chain of nine carbon atoms.
